Edge computing, veri işlemenin merkezi bulut yerine veri kaynağına yakın (edge) yapılmasıdır. IoT, gerçek zamanlı uygulamalar ve düşük gecikme gerektiren senaryolar için kritik bir teknolojidir.
Edge Computing Nedir?
Verinin üretildiği yerde işlenmesi:
- Sensörler ve IoT cihazları
- Edge gateway'ler
- Edge servers
- CDN nodes
Cloud vs Edge
| Cloud | Edge |
|---|---|
| Merkezi | Dağıtık |
| Yüksek gecikme | Düşük gecikme (<10ms) |
| Bant genişliği gerekli | Lokal işleme |
| Sınırsız ölçek | Kaynak sınırlı |
Kullanım Senaryoları
- Autonomous Vehicles: ms seviyesinde karar
- Smart Factory: Gerçek zamanlı kalite kontrol
- Video Analytics: Güvenlik kameraları
- Gaming: Cloud gaming, AR/VR
- Healthcare: Patient monitoring
- Retail: In-store analytics
Edge Mimarisi
[Devices/Sensors] → [Edge Gateway] → [Edge Server] → [Cloud]
↑ ↑ ↑ ↑
Data Gen Filtering Processing Storage
+ Protocol + Analytics + Training
Edge AI
- TensorFlow Lite
- PyTorch Mobile
- NVIDIA Jetson
- Google Coral
- Intel Neural Compute Stick
Edge Platformlar
- AWS: IoT Greengrass, Wavelength
- Azure: IoT Edge, Stack Edge
- Google: Distributed Cloud Edge
- Cloudflare: Workers (serverless edge)
Zorluklar
- Device management at scale
- Security (distributed attack surface)
- Connectivity reliability
- Data consistency
- Edge-cloud orchestration
5G ve Edge
5G'nin düşük gecikme ve yüksek bant genişliği, edge computing'i güçlendiriyor: MEC (Multi-access Edge Computing).
Edge computing, verinin değerini üretildiği anda yakalamak için vazgeçilmezdir.